Output 76c8bd98258fe83b0de3e5875e158cd120ee666fcb6b2a462ab81990144d0b1e:0

value
507064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df01357a8ed6a9b87362b9c6668026aa6203f4a OP_EQUAL
address
3K1KEYNqS1ZFpCSj7ogoH7tSzhP7VioN64
transaction
76c8bd98258fe83b0de3e5875e158cd120ee666fcb6b2a462ab81990144d0b1e
spent
true